Really interesting play about rage and how it can consume us. This comedy/ drama unfolds after one person kills his business partner. We watch a lot of characters lives converge ala "Crash" as they search for love and accceptance. Very funny at times. The only thing I found wrong with it, is that with plays like this, there is a certain amount of contrivance with having all the characters meet at some point, but it is handled with about as much flair and stucture as possible. Good acting and directing.
